RODRIGUEZ MORATA, Alejandro; REYES ORTEGA, Juan Pedro; ROBLES MARTIN, Mª Luisa e GALLARDO PEDRAJAS, Fernando. The dark spots of pelvic venous insufficiency. Angiología [online]. 2020, vol.72, n.5, pp.253-264. Epub 30-Nov-2020. ISSN 1695-2987. https://dx.doi.org/10.20960/angiologia.00147.
Pelvic Venous Insufficiency is a topic of much debate in Congresses of our professional field. However, the more this pathology is recognized and treated in our setting, the more cases we find in which applying a standard venous embolization or stenting, treatment results in an unfavorable result. To avoid this type of results, we must carefully study the abdomino-pelvic venous circulation, establishing parallels with the infrainguinal venous circulation, and also apply IVUS technology in cases of doubt. With these two measures, we can face this pathology as a whole with very positive results for our patients.
